Output 2ec89366b189c21f1a9c92f6f1a26b2ec796ddc5afce8213ef19b7cd44c5f12f:1

value
684000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e1bea3c902bb5504fc738880360dace1dc28657 OP_EQUAL
address
37MRG1DSDqiXyMzzmVtw3Qruv1dBA5reXP
transaction
2ec89366b189c21f1a9c92f6f1a26b2ec796ddc5afce8213ef19b7cd44c5f12f
spent
true